Transaction 65ff4fd807e663100d7ddee2cc35fe59d034d9f28d358316198bcdcb09524aed
1 Input
2 Outputs
- 65ff4fd807e663100d7ddee2cc35fe59d034d9f28d358316198bcdcb09524aed:0
- 65ff4fd807e663100d7ddee2cc35fe59d034d9f28d358316198bcdcb09524aed:1
value 1592616
address 122oiZKNGi6KhkdsZhHzbJiwNSZrckoJhk
value 2514294
address 18TMJbYYDbA5yDMmARgAV7PZRLt2TJyY4g